Created By Annie Jennings PR, National Publicist  

Innovation Strategy And The Elephant In The Room

A good friend and colleague of mine is an expert in innovation strategy. He has held professorships at leading business schools in Europe and has worked with the top management of a number of large corporations on their business strategies. [...]